Rarity Breakdown
Pro Set's Desert Storm series was produced in large quantities typical of the early-90s overproduction era, meaning base cards like this one carry no inherent scarcity from a print run standpoint. The set lacks the kind of short-printed inserts or chase parallels that drive strong secondary market demand, placing most individual cards in the common tier regardless of subject matter. The single active listing may reflect low seller interest rather than true scarcity, which is an important distinction for collectors evaluating this card's availability.
Investment Outlook
The Desert Storm set benefits from periodic nostalgia cycles tied to Gulf War anniversaries and renewed public interest in early-90s military history, which can temporarily lift demand across the series. Set completionists represent the most consistent buyer base here, as the property itself lacks the ongoing franchise activity — such as new films or reboots — that typically drives sustained crossover collector interest. The outlook remains stable but modest, with upside most likely tied to graded high-population scarcity rather than broad market momentum.
